Maryssa Stumpf is a 20 year old aspiring fashion designer who lives with her family in Vista, CA. After her father suffered two massive strokes three years ago, her life was changed in ways she could have never predicted and her dreams of attending the Fashion Institute of Design and Merchandising (FIDM) were put on hold to help care for her father. But Maryssa's resilient spirit did not let her dreams fade as life threw obstacles her way. Just after she discovered she wouldn’t be able to attend fashion school, she began creating "DIY" fashion videos on YouTube. One year later she has over 700 subscribers to her videos and is a contributing writer/videographer for FashionClub.com and FashionIndie.com. Maryssa hopes to inspire other girls with her story of triumph through tragedy in hopes that they too will find the inspiration and confidence to accomplish every one of their goals as well.
